Snowkiting without Wind – Snow Park Project

After testing out the prototype of the Sesitec System 2 in Germany, we instantly knew that this system was going to have many different roles. We’ve been talking about setting up the System 2 in the snow since its conception, and now we did. Sesitec owner Christen Lerchenfeld went over to the Vivaldi snowboard park [Vivaldi Park Ski World] in South Korea and helped our friends from HydroTrax set one up at the base of a snowboard run. What a great way to make use of the flat land around snowboard resorts. Put in a small table top and a hand rail and now you’ve turned your unusable area into a snow park. It’s the perfect way to get some good one-on-one instruction sessions. It was brilliant, everyone had such a good time and it seems the snow resort wants to make the Sesitec System 2 a permanent feature. The boys from HydroTrax are currently doing a tour of snow resorts in South Korea, and there is talk of snow resorts in the U.S. wanting the same thing from The Wake Park Project. Watch for more System 2 snow park setups near you.
